cronicle

cronicle

Docker app from TheBrian's Repository

Overview

Cronicle is a multi-server task scheduler and runner, with a web based front-end UI. It handles both scheduled, repeating and on-demand jobs, targeting any number of worker servers, with real-time stats and live log viewer. It's basically a fancy Cron replacement written in Node.js. You can give it simple shell commands, or write Plugins in virtually any language. A huge thank you to github.com/jhuckab for the Cronicle project and github.com/soulteary for the container!

Runtime arguments

Web UI
http://[IP]:[PORT:3012]
Network
bridge
Shell
sh
Privileged
false

Template configuration

Web Interface PortPorttcp

The port cronicle will listen on.

Target
3012
Default
3012
Value
3012
Stateful Data PathPathrw

Internal Container Path: /opt/cronicle/data

Target
/opt/cronicle/data
Default
/mnt/user/appdata/cronicle/data
Value
/mnt/user/appdata/cronicle/data
Stateful Logs PathPathrw

Internal Container Path: /opt/cronicle/logs

Target
/opt/cronicle/logs
Default
/mnt/user/appdata/cronicle/logs
Value
/mnt/user/appdata/cronicle/logs
Stateful Plugins PathPathrw

Internal Container Path: /opt/cronicle/plugins

Target
/opt/cronicle/plugins
Default
/mnt/user/appdata/cronicle/plugins
Value
/mnt/user/appdata/cronicle/plugins

Download Statistics

213,699
Total Downloads
13,873
This Month
11,028
Avg / Month

Total Downloads Over Time

Loading chart...

Details

Repository
soulteary/cronicle:latest
Last Updated2025-06-02
First Seen2024-07-04

Run Cronicle on Unraid.

Cronicle is listed in Community Apps for Unraid OS. Explore Unraid to build a flexible home server, NAS, or homelab.